Email Retargeting and Boosting Customer Engagement

Smile.io

This may include visitors who abandoned their shopping carts, customers who made past purchases, and subscribers who clicked on certain links in your previous emails. In email retargeting, pixels or browser cookies collect data on a user's behavior and actions, such as website visits, product views, or abandoned carts.
